The $50 Gold Eagle is a gold bullion coin issued by the United States Mint, containing one troy ounce of 22-karat gold. The coin features a design of Lady Liberty on the obverse and a family of eagles on the reverse. The 2003 edition of the Gold Eagle was minted in Philadelphia and is part of a series that began in 1986, aiming to reflect the beauty and history of American coinage while serving as a reliable investment vehicle. Collectors often seek specific years and mint marks, making the 2003 Philadelphia issue particularly significant among enthusiasts of U.S. gold coins.
